How tight should a suit vest be?

A properly fitted waistcoat should be snug in the body but not so tight that the buttons pull. It should also be long enough to hit about an inch below the trouser waistband, showing no dress shirt between the two garments.

Do you wear a belt with a 3 piece suit?

Too long of a vest starts to look absurd, so the trousers on a good three piece suit will be fitted high, around the natural waist, and should ideally be worn with suspenders. A belt may cause bulging in the waistcoat fabric and will be completely hidden, rendering it unnecessary.

What Colour waistcoat goes with a GREY suit?

Navy and grey are traditional, but a waistcoat in olive green or wine red can add a pop of colour that will really turn heads. If you don't know what the dress code is, match the colour of your waistcoat to the trousers and suit jacket.

How do you wear a down vest?

On a mild day in fall or spring, you can wear a puffer vest in place of a jacket. It will keep you warm but not too warm, regulating your body temperature indoors and out. Wear it with chinos, jeans and slim sweatpants, paired with long sleeve t-shirts or flannel shirts.
